What does "burnout treatment" actually mean?

People often think: "I'll take a break and then everything will be fine." But the truth is that it's much more than that. Sustainable support for burnout includes

  • Diagnostics: Recognizing physical, psychological and social aspects.
  • Acute relief: reduction of stressors (e.g. less work, more rest).
  • Therapy and reorientation: strategies for coping with stress, new life balance.

In short, help with burnout doesn't just mean "taking time out", but Use time out, to build new.

Which ways out of burnout really work?

Here are concrete methods: not just "sounds good" but scientifically sound.

1. psychotherapy & coaching

  • Professional support helps enormously in cases of deep exhaustion or entrenched patterns.
  • Approaches:
    • C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T): recognizing and changing thought and behavior patterns
    • Systemic therapy: reflecting on roles, relationships, environment
  • Tip: Choose someone with experience in burnout therapy.

2. relaxation & physical regeneration

  • Methods such as progressive muscle relaxation, yoga or mindfulness bring back balance.
  • Why it helps: The body is part of the healing process: relaxation activates self-healing.
  • Small exercise: 5 minutes of conscious breathing, twice a day.

3. rethink lifestyle & work-life balance

  • Burnout is often caused by constant stress, excessive demands and incorrect self-management.
  • Ask yourself:
    • What can I delegate or reduce?
    • Where do I need clearer boundaries?
    • Which rituals nourish me?
  • Focus: More "I may", less "I must".

Frequently asked questions answered clearly

Is burnout an illness?
No, it is not an official diagnosis like depression, but it is a serious condition that should be treated.

Does a wellness weekend help?
In the short term, yes. In the long term, we need profound change and clarity.

What role do medications play?
They can alleviate symptoms (e.g. insomnia), but are not a solution to the causes.

How long does burnout therapy take?
That is individual. But: Recognized early = faster return to energy.
